Tánaiste praises 'fair' Budget

The Tánaiste and Social Protection Minister has said the Budget announced today is fair.

Joan Burton said families, older people and low and middle-income workers would all benefit from the measures.

There will be no reductions in existing welfare payments and supports next year, while there will be a €5 increase in child benefit payments in 2015 and 2016.

25% of the Christmas bonus is also being restored as part of the package of measures.

The Tánaiste said Budget 2015 marked a decisive shift.

"The economy is growing, unemployment is falling and confidence is returning," she said. "The first phase of our recovery as a country is complete, and we're now starting the second - restoring living standards for families, older people and low- and middle-income workers."
